Matamoras Pennsylvania Weather Trends

Matamoras Precipitation

In the last year, Matamoras Pennsylvania received 69.92 inches of precipitation, ranking it in the 88th percentile in the nation and the 90th percentile in Pennsylvania. Comparing this to the national average of 50.61 inches and Pennsylvania’s average of 59.53 inches, it’s clear that Matamoras experiences higher precipitation levels. Matamoras’s UV Rating

In the last year, Matamoras Pennsylvania had an average UV rating of 3.62, positioning it in the 24th percentile in the nation and the 38th percentile in Pennsylvania. When compared to the national average of 4.29 and Pennsylvania’s average of 3.82, Matamoras may seem to receive less sunlight. However, with an average max UV rating of 3.93, there is still plenty of solar energy potential to take advantage of. Matamoras’s Cloud Cover

In the last year, Matamoras Pennsylvania had an average of 51% cloud cover, placing it in the 78th percentile in the nation and the 42nd percentile in Pennsylvania. While the cloud cover percentage may be higher compared to the national average of 44.46% and Pennsylvania’s average of 51.8%, there are still plenty of clear days for solar energy production. Matamoras Pennsylvania Electricity Costs

Matamoras Pennsylvania residents pay about $0.12/kw for electricity, ranking in the 57th percentile in the nation and the 15th percentile in Pennsylvania. When looking at the national average of $0.13/kw and Pennsylvania’s average of $0.13/kw, Matamoras enjoys slightly lower electricity costs.
